How to set primary key in laravel

WebApr 13, 2024 · Build a CI/CD pipeline with GitHub Actions. Create a folder named .github in the root of your project, and inside it, create workflows/main.yml; the path should be .github/workflows/main.yml to get GitHub Actions working on your project. workflows is a file that contains the automation process. WebNov 10, 2024 · Riadh Rahmi Senior Web Developer PHP/Drupal. I am a senior web developer, I have experience in planning and developing large scale dynamic websites especially in …

How to Make a Composite Primary Key in PHP using Eloquent in a Laravel …

WebOct 30, 2024 · Here we explain how to create primary key in laravel. laravel primary key migration. Create a string column to primary key. Table primary key is unique column of a … Web1 day ago · I've been tasked with debuggin outsource team code. Its a laravel vue admin panel. Problem: whenever user tries to Edit a kid character, although in admin panel, below upload image field, the previously uploaded image is shown, unless he re uploads another image , he gets toast notif "image field is required". how do you join the labour party https://wcg86.com

Use UUID as primary key of Laravel Eloquent ORM. - Medium

WebBest Answer You can add a $primaryKey attribute to your model to specify a custom primary key name public $primarykey = 'name_id'; From the docs : Eloquent will also assume that each table has a primary key column named id. You may define a $primaryKey property to override this convention. http://laravel.com/docs/5.1/eloquent 9 Reply Level 3 krenor Webbehind scene of $table->id (); is $table->bigInteger ('id')->primary (); but in uuid case you have to define these properties $table->uuid ('id')->primary (); 2 Reply Level 1 Jahchap Posted 2 years ago # From Laravel 7.15, you can now use $table->foreignUuid ('deleted_by_id')->references ('id')->on ('users'); 5 Reply Level 14 Subscriber datarecall WebJan 2, 2012 · CREATE DATABASE `blog` D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ci; USE `blog`; CREATE TABLE IF NOT EXISTS `article` ( `id` INT(10) UNSIGNED NOT NULL AUTO_INCREMENT, `timestamp` datetime NOT NULL, `title` VARCHAR(128) NOT NULL, `summary` VARCHAR(128) NOT NULL, `content` text NOT NULL, `author` … how do you join the links

sql_require_primary_key Causes Tables With String Primary Key …

Category:How to create primary key in laravel migration

Tags:How to set primary key in laravel

How to set primary key in laravel

Laravel: How to set the Primary Key and Foreign Key to string

WebMar 4, 2024 · The answer is quite simple, just try to define the new or the actual primary key field name within the class as shown below : protected $primaryKey = "id_mytable"; On the above line, it means that there is a field for primary key named ‘id_mytable’ exist in the table named ‘mytable’. Share this: Like this: Loading... WebMay 25, 2024 · Default primary key for Laravel Model is using increment integer, for reference. In some case, developer want to use another type such as UUID. What is UUID? In short, UUID stands for...

How to set primary key in laravel

Did you know?

WebBest Answer First you make one primary key: $table ->bigIncrements ( 'id' ); then you trying to create another one primary key: $table ->primary ( [ 'user_id', 'permission_id' ]); You can't create 2 primary index, but you cant create compound primary index. WebYou most likely forgot to also set the type of your role_id foreign key as BIGINT(20) as well. This isn't really a Laravel issue, but rather MySQL's. By the way, Laravel does have a native function to do this:

WebAug 7, 2024 · Laravel Version: 5.5.×; PHP Version: 7.2; Database Driver & Version: Description: When the table model does not have an auto-increment field and the single model sets primary_key, the model query results automatically set the primary_key field of the last data to zero WebJun 26, 2024 · We will import it in any Eloquent model that will require a UUID primary key. Create a new folder Traits, and create a new file Uuids.php For any Laravel version from 5.6 and above, add the...

WebApr 19, 2024 · By default, eloquent assume that each model has a primary key column named id. But if you need to change the primary key with your own custom column name … WebAug 7, 2024 · Laravel Version: 5.5.×; PHP Version: 7.2; Database Driver & Version: Description: When the table model does not have an auto-increment field and the single …

WebMar 19, 2024 · Use UUID as primary key of Laravel Eloquent ORM. by Jangwook Kim Medium 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find...

WebNov 1, 2016 · I am trying to change the default primary key from id of users table to userId, but Laravel authentication mechanism always checks for id from users table. Example: Users::check () and Users::attempt () These functions always check for id attribute of … phone battery swellingWebOn the model, you can specify the table using variable named $table, to specify primary key you can use variable named $primaryKey (with capital letter K). Here's an example of model Car (car.php), this model has primary key 'car_id' instead of just 'id'. class Car extends Eloquent { protected $table = 'cars'; protected $primaryKey = 'car_id'; } how do you join the naacpWebTo get started, execute the schema:dump command: php artisan schema:dump # Dump the current database schema and prune all existing migrations... php artisan schema:dump --prune When you execute this command, Laravel will write a "schema" file to your application's database/schema directory. how do you join the freemasonsphone beamerWebNov 16, 2013 · If you are wanting to use a composite key (a string) You need to make sure you set public $incrementing = false otherwise laravel will cast the field to an Integer, … how do you join the masonic fraternityWebCreate a migration that creates a new table with a string as the primary key (we used $table->string ('string')->primary ();) and does not have a default $table->id (); column Run the migration Run the default Laravel migrations (add a primary key where necessary) on a machine where the flag is turned off (Homestead for example) phone battery replacement nearbyWebMar 15, 2024 · 1. Database Configuration Open .env file. Specify the host, database name, username, and password. DB_CONNECTION=mysql DB_HOST=127.0.0.1 DB_PORT=3306 DB_DATABASE=tutorial DB_USERNAME=root DB_PASSWORD= 2. Create Table and add Foreign Key Create countries, states, and cities tables using migration. I am adding … how do you join the national guard